| Sumario: | [EN] The objective of this article is to analyze the values transmitted by the first season of the children s cartoon series Bluey (Joe Brumm, 2018). It is presented through a mixed research that combines qualitative and quantitative approaches. The instruments used are observation and semi-structured interview. The results show that, although most of the values of the educational system are present, justice, tolerance, inclusion, and solidarity are underrepresented. Despite its many positive aspects, such as discipline and honesty, it also reproduces undesirable stereotypes and attitudes. Once again the importance of media literacy is projected and the cartoon series Bluey is valued as a teaching resource and object of study. |
